Democratic

Ben Koehler

Candidate for Arizona State House – District 20

Arizona · Legislative District 20

Statement

We need to build a strong public education system so that every child has genuine access to the resources that will set them up for success. We need to limit corporate greed and strengthen the power of workers. We need economic development that lifts our communities up instead of extracting natural resources and raising the cost of utilities. I am running for State Representative to create the government that we deserve, a government that fights on behalf of the people. As your elected representative I will only pursue policies that are focused on bettering the lives of the everyday neighbor in our district. The first action I've taken to back up my word is running as a Clean Elections candidate. Instead of relying on donations from wealthy individuals and outside organizations, the only voices and wallets I care about are those of constituents in LD 20. My role as an elected official is to listen to your voice, amplify your message, and advocate on your behalf. I cannot nor would I want to walk this path alone, please reach out to share your ideas, concerns, and voice so that we can build the government that we deserve together.

Biography

After visiting family in Arizona for all of my life, I moved to Tucson in August of 2020. Like many, I came for the University of Arizona but fell in love with everything Tucson has to offer. Instead of practicing when I graduated from the College of Law with my J.D. I decided to stay in the classroom, now as a teacher. The last couple years teaching math at Pueblo High School have been the most rewarding. I look forward to advocating on behalf of and representing the community that has become my chosen home.
